AIH DELETED
Well I finally got my boost gauge hooked into the AIH port. I just used the hardware you would buy to hook up a mechanical oil pressure gauge and screwed the brass fittings into my aih port and hooked up my boost line just like an oil pressure line, worked great. Only question now is what do you do with the red power line that was hooked in the AIH? I just put electrical tape on mine for temp.
